One Punch Man




What does it mean to be a hero? What character does a hero have? What everyday problems can a hero face in our society? Through the story of Saitama, our protagonist, we get a glimpse into the daily life of a hero. Japan at this time is in danger from different threats that can destroy the peace of its citizens and we will discover what makes Saitama different from other characters who call themselves heroes. His main characteristic is that he is capable of defeating any enemy with just one punch, hence why he is called One Punch Man. In his career as a hero, Saitama has developed a parsimony exaggerated by the lack of true rivals in his life: We will see the consequences of this characteristic in his character and how it affects the different people that will appear in his life.

It is a fun series, but also a philosophical one. It raises questions about the qualities that a hero must have, and at the same time, it highlights everything that calls itself a hero and is not. Also, Saitama’s enemies challenge him in a psychological way, not just a physical one, giving each fight a deeper meaning than simply being the strongest, because what does it mean to be truly strong, indomitable?
